Ultragenyx: Pipeline Progress Amidst Financial Hurdles

Detailed Analysis

  • On October 1, 2025, Ultragenyx appointed Eric Olson as Chief Business Officer (CBO) and Executive Vice President, bringing nearly two decades of biopharma experience and over $15 billion in transaction value expertise. This signals a strategic focus on partnerships and growth, potentially unlocking value from their pipeline.
  • Ultragenyx’s Q2 2025 earnings, discussed in October, beat analyst expectations with EPS of -$1.17 (versus an estimated -$1.27) and revenue of $166.50 million, a 13.2% year-over-year increase. While still reporting a loss, this positive surprise suggests improving momentum and operational execution.
  • The company is projecting significant growth, anticipating $1.4 billion in revenue and $46.9 million in earnings by 2028, based on a 32.0% annual revenue growth rate. However, this turnaround relies on overcoming a current loss of $-532.9 million, highlighting the inherent risks.
  • Despite the positive projections, Ultragenyx currently operates with negative free cash flow exceeding $206 million and a -87.3% profit margin as of October 7, 2025. Analysts anticipate adjusted earnings of $-5.058 per share for the current fiscal year, indicating continued near-term financial challenges.
  • Analysts remain overwhelmingly positive on Ultragenyx, with 19 "Buy" ratings and one "Hold" rating as of October 7, 2025, and an average target price of $86.89, representing a potential 187.83% upside. This strong sentiment suggests confidence in the company’s long-term prospects despite current financial hurdles.
  • Wealth Enhancement Advisory Services LLC acquired a new position in Ultragenyx on October 8, 2025, purchasing 8,848 shares valued at approximately $353,000. This new institutional investment further reinforces the positive outlook from analysts and other investors.
  • Simply Wall St News indicated on October 3, 2025, that Ultragenyx is currently “64.1% Undervalued” with a fair value estimate of $86.05, despite a 42% decline in total shareholder return over the past year. This suggests a potential opportunity for investors, contingent on pipeline success.

Looking Ahead: Investors should closely monitor the progress of UX143 and GTX-102 clinical trials, with data readouts anticipated by year-end 2025 and in 2026, respectively. Further updates on financial performance and cash flow management will also be critical.
